Ranchi: BJP has intensified its campaign demanding the death penalty for the killers of the Kusumba Vishnugarh girl, calling the crime “rarest of the rare.” Party state president and MP Aditya Sahu criticized the Jharkhand government for the failure of law and order and said daughters in the state are unsafe. Addressing a press conference at his Delhi residence, Sahu said the brutal murder and mutilation of the girl after the Ramnavami Mangalwari procession has left the public shocked and terrified.
Sahu accused the state government of insensitivity, pointing out that even six days after the incident, Chief Minister Hemant Soren had not condemned the crime or issued directives for action. He expressed gratitude to the Jharkhand High Court for taking suo motu cognizance and directing senior officials, including the DGP and Chief Secretary, to act.
BJP has been supporting the victim’s family, providing financial aid and helping the father return home. Demonstrations have taken place across Hazaribagh and other districts demanding immediate arrest of the accused. Sahu warned that if the culprits are not arrested within two days, BJP will organize torch rallies in district and block headquarters on April 2, followed by a statewide shutdown on April 3.
Sahu also criticized statements by the state finance minister, calling the Congress party insensitive and accusing the government of treating such crimes as routine. He said justice for the victim will be served only when the perpetrators are hanged. BJP vice president and MP Dr. Pradeep Verma and MP Dhullu Mahto were also present at the press briefing.
